val generate_code : (X86_ast.asm_line list -> unit) option -> unitPost-process the stream of instructions. Dump it (using the provided syntax emitter) in a file (if provided) and compile it with an internal assembler (if registered through register_internal_assembler).
Generate an object file corresponding to the last call to generate_code. An internal assembler is used if available (and the input file is ignored). Otherwise, the source asm file with an external assembler.
